OFW who tested positive for COVID-19 in Hong Kong now in 'stable condition’


The Filipina migrant worker who tested positive for the co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) is now in "normal and stable condition," the Philippine Consulate General in Hong Kong said on Wednesday evening.

"Maganda ang kanyang disposisyon at hindi siya kinakikitaan ng sintomas ng sakit gaya ng sipon, ubo at lagnat. Siya ay nasa mabuting pangangalaga bagamat ipinagbabawal sa kasaluyan ang personal na pagbisita sa ospital," the Consulate General said in a written statement.

Doctors said that the OFW can be discharged if the succeeding tests showed negative results for the China virus.

The Consul General asked members of the public to refrain from disclosing the worker's identity and to respect her privacy.

In the statement, the Consul General also urged to the public to refrain from spreading unverified information and fake news about the COVID-19 outbreak.

According to South China Morning Post, the Filipina worker was identified as the 61st confirmed case of COVID-19 in Hong Kong. —Angelica Yang/LDF, GMA News
